The Body Shop: Tea Tree Face Mask

Hi everyone!

Today's review is of The Body Shop's Tea Tree Face Mask. This mask is intended for blemished skin and they claim it "instantly cools and lifts away impurities." I purchases this single use size which contains enough product for one use so that I could see if I liked it before purchasing a full-size  of the face mask. The sample retails for $2.50 and contains 0.2 oz (a generous amount!) of product, and you can purchase it from Ulta and The Body Shop. A full-size of the face mask comes in a pot with 100 mL and retails for $15.50 from Ulta and The Body Shop. This face mask is one of The Body Shop's bestsellers! They describe it as leaving the "skin feeling deeply cleansed and refreshed with an instantly cooling mask that helps remove impurities and absorb excess oil while soothing and calming blemish-prone skin. Community Fair Trade tea tree oil, lemon tea tree, and tamanu oil work together to keep skin clear by helping to prevent blemishes and blackheads, and controlling excess oil. Menthol creates a cool fresh tingle that leaves skin feeling calm and refreshed." This product is 100% Vegetarian, Never Tested on Animals, Contains Community Fair Trade Ingredients, No Sulfates, No Phthalates, No GMOs, and No Triclosan. The Body Shop recommends applying this product by "Smooth a thin layer onto pat-dried skin, clean face and neck with your fingertips. Leave for 5 to 10 minutes (mask will not dry). Then rinse off with clean water and pat skin dry. Use once or twice per week, after cleansing."
This product is ideal for oily skin, but I found that it worked amazingly well on my skin. (For reference, my skin is normal to dry and I do have occasional breakouts.) I used this mask when I was experiencing lots of breakouts from a Lush face mask that I reviewed previously (Link HERE). I was amazed at how quickly my breakouts disappeared and how smooth my skin felt immediately after using this mask. It also really soothed my skin and helped reduce the irritation associated with the breakouts on my face. I think those who experience bad acne breakouts will absolutely love this mask, but I also think those people who only have occasional breakouts will also love this mask as it's incredibly soothing and helps keep your skin smooth, cleansed and blemish-free. I did notice a slight tingle when using this mask but it was actually pretty minimal, yet powerful at acne-fighting at the same time. I really liked that this mask was effective but also didn't completely dry out my skin like some blemish-fighting masks do. While it wasn't necessarily hydrating, it didn't strip my skin of its moisture.

Final Verdict:
Overall, I really loved using this face mask! It was soothing yet effective at the same time. The results were instantaneous (soft, smooth skin) yet long-term (reduced redness and breakouts) as well. I highly recommend this mask to everyone, because I truly believe it's a universally flattering mask that will help all skin types and is for people of all ages. I loved this mask so much that I have already purchased a full-sized pot of it. Definitely check this face mask out!

Lush: Ayesha Fresh Face Mask

Hi everyone,

The first item I'm reviewing today is the Ayesha Fresh Face Mask which was recommended to me by a Lush Sales Associate when I told her I was interested in a mask for dry skin that was targeted at removing dead skin and brightening the face. I'm not entirely sure this was the best mask for me, but since this was my first visit in a long while I took her advice and bought it.
This facial mask contains 2.1 oz of product and is vegetarian and preservative-free. This mask retails for $6.95 so it's very affordable and I think you could probably get between 3 and 5 uses out of it depending on how much you apply each time. This is a "fresh" product from Lush so you have to keep it in the refrigerator and they last about 2-3 weeks. I bought mine on 10/15 and it says it expires on 11/4 so you do have to use it fairly quickly. Also, once you bring back 5 face mask pots to Lush you'll get a free facial mask so in essence buy 5 get 1 free!
Lush describes the Ayesha Fresh Face Mask as "a blend of tightening and toning ingredients to refresh tired-looking skin. We use vitamin C-rich kiwi to brighten dull spots, asparagus to nourish and absorb excess oils and honey for hydrating and soothing red areas. This fresh mask is named after the fictional priestess who discovered the secret to immortality - ten minutes with it on and you’ll see why! Dull, tired and mature skin transforms for a bright, youthful glow."

To use this face mask, cleanse your face first and pat dry, then smooth a good amount of the product all over your entire face (avoiding the eyes and mouth). You should leave the mask on for about ten minutes but make sure to not let the mask dry completely.
So first off, I didn't realize this mask was intended for mature skin until I got home and read more about it. Had I known it was I probably wouldn't have gotten it as I'm 24 years old and definitely do not have mature skin. Nonetheless, I did find that this mask left my face ultra smooth and it made my skin feel tight (in a good way). It also took away all the dead skin on my face and left me really shiny for a day or two which is what I assume they refer to as the "youthful glow".

I was also very turned off by the smell of this product. It's a very strong earthy and herbal scent. I think you have to smell it for yourself to determine if you like it or not, but be aware that it's a very strong and overpowering scent.

Results:
So first the good side of this mask! Immediately after using this mask, my skin felt very soft and I could feel that my skin was nice and tight. Additionally, my pores were pretty much nonexistent after using this mask, which is something I'm always looking for in a face mask.

Now, on the negative side, with the dead skin removed from my face, I found that my skin on my face was very shiny and it even showed through my foundation and makeup. Even more problematic than that, I experienced some MASSIVE breakouts a couple of days after using this mask. I'm not talking small breakouts, I mean large breakouts and the kind the hurt under the skin.

Final Verdict:
I liked how smooth and tight this product made my skin and face feel immediately after using it, but I hate how I had massive, painful breakouts from it. I definitely won't be finishing the pot because the breakouts just aren't worth it to me. I definitely think this would be a great product for mature skin as it does have a great lifting sensation and for those who are not prone to breakouts, as that was my biggest problem with this mask.
